Program
Students will be able to develop technical, educational, relational, clinical reasoning, care organization and planning and evidence-based approach skills through the following laboratory activities: - Informing and educating students - Communication techniques applied to practical situations - research exercises on scientific sources and interpretation to make healthcare decisions - preparation of theses - nursing assignments - assignment of activities to social and healthcare workers - priority and organization of healthcare activities - management of central vascular access and drug therapy in critical areas - techniques first aid: safety positioning, immobilization of the traumatized patient, tamponade of a hemorrhage, shockable and non-shockable rhythms - Decision making and promotion of self-care behaviors of the person with liver failure
